If you’re happy to leave your audio 6 plugged in when the other dj plays then switching to audio thruis the easiest thing in the world. Unplug your laptop from the audio 6 (as long as the power supply is connected) and it will automatically switch to thru mode.

NB. MAKE SURE AUDIO 6 POWER SUPPLY IS CONNECTED!!!

Or click the deck letter ie A and next to it you can switch deck from scratch control to thru mode.

Why didn’t you just switch to using your x1 to control deck playback when the deck went down. at the end of the day you should be able to play with one x1 and a mixer no worries. Switch off scratch mode.

Would also have an ipod plugged in at all times on a spare channel so you can hit play while you sort out any grief.
